From radiant to sultry, last night’s beauty moments were unforgettable. Find out who made MEGA’s list of best beauty, from Kathryn Bernardo and Elisse Joson, Andrea Brillantes to Kai Montinola.

here’s no shortage of sartorial splendor when the red carpet rolls out. Stars come out to play in their finest ensembles, but look closer and you’ll see: beauty emerges as the undisputed star of the night. The women of the ABS-CBN Ball: Brighter Together served nothing less than radiance in their own way—from Kathryn Bernardo’s luminous look to Michelle Dee’s sultry allure. Which beauty moment had you hooked? Here are our top picks.

Kathryn Bernardo

makeup by owen sarmiento, hair by john valle
Kathryn Bernardo walked in like a quiet storm—glass skin with a satin sheen, a diffused lip, and eyes glazed with strategic gleam. Her hair was tousled to perfection in loose bombshell waves, walking the line between effortless and unmistakably divine.

 

Belle Mariano

makeup by jake galvez, hair by rj delA cruz
Enter the belle of the ball. Draped in Francis Libiran florals, Mariano turned the red carpet into her own stage. But it was her beauty—skin like dew, very minimal makeup, and that unexpected pop of Tiffany blue at the eyes—that made us stop and stare.

 

Elisse Joson

Makeup by thazzia falek, hair by renz pangilinan
Springtime arrived when Elisse Joson did. Clad in lemon-yellow lace, she paired the look with a beauty beat as fresh as it gets—a glazed nude lip, a whisper of pink across the cheeks, and luminous eyes that kept her glowing all night long.

 

Julia Barretto

Makeup by robbie pinera, hair by raymond santiago
There were plenty of updos that evening, but Julia Barretto’s tousled chignon was a clear frontrunner. Paired with a soft glam beat that gave her eyes a foxy lift and the lightest wash of nude across her face, her entire look screamed spring.

 

Sofia Andres

makeup by miz raffy, hair by Anton papa
Sofia gave us a quieter take on the season’s beauty, but it was far from dull. Her nude Andrea Tetangco wrap paired with a bronzed beat, and her slickly undone hair kept the focus firmly on her golden features.

 

Janine Gutierrez

makeup by anthea bueno, hair by jay aquino
Gone were the long, sweeping waves—Janine Gutierrez arrived with something short and sharp. Her freshly chopped hair was slicked back, framing her face like a modern sculpture, while frosted lips and lids added a nod to ‘90s glamour.

 

Janella Salvador

makeup by carissa cielo medved, hair by justine ocampo
Was it a ball or a fairytale? Janella Salvador made it hard to tell. Her sleek hair contrasted sharply with a dreamy makeup look, where shades of purple echoed her Ehrran Montoya piece. Her look was like something out of a fantasy.

 

Andrea Brillantes

makeup by anthea bueno, hair by rj dela cruz
Andrea Brillantes swapped her usual voluminous gowns for a power suit. Her beauty was equally sharp: a deep crimson lip, bronzed contours, and an extra-long ponytail that snatched the look in all the right places.

 

Michelle Dee

makeup by dave quiambao, hair by nelly seboy
Miss Universe Philippines 2023 stunned like a statue carved from elegance. Her hair, sculpted into finger waves, reminded the crowd of the opulent ‘20s. The beat was rich in sultry browns, adding to the depth and mysterious allure of the queen.

 

Kai Montinola

makeup by paul unating, hair by brent sales
If the dictionary had visual aids, find Kai Montinola’s portrait next to “blooming.” Her look was an instant magnet, with delicate pinks sweeping across her eyes, cheeks, and lips. Her luminous beat made her beauty feel like spring in motion.
